summaryrefslogtreecommitdiff
path: root/sys-libs/libmodulemd
diff options
context:
space:
mode:
authorV3n3RiX <venerix@koprulu.sector>2023-05-17 04:08:35 +0100
committerV3n3RiX <venerix@koprulu.sector>2023-05-17 04:08:35 +0100
commit43f85394ba834267589a4e6478ef419d40e22503 (patch)
treeb54082395e0e153c889b6dfe60d580a57992b3e8 /sys-libs/libmodulemd
parentc4507bfdfd706b2b1301972490fe88ac3ddbc70e (diff)
gentoo auto-resync : 17:05:2023 - 04:08:35
Diffstat (limited to 'sys-libs/libmodulemd')
-rw-r--r--sys-libs/libmodulemd/Manifest5
-rw-r--r--sys-libs/libmodulemd/files/libmodulemd-2.14.0-meson-version.patch61
-rw-r--r--sys-libs/libmodulemd/libmodulemd-2.15.0.ebuild (renamed from sys-libs/libmodulemd/libmodulemd-2.14.0.ebuild)2
3 files changed, 2 insertions, 66 deletions
diff --git a/sys-libs/libmodulemd/Manifest b/sys-libs/libmodulemd/Manifest
index 695730663af5..564839001d88 100644
--- a/sys-libs/libmodulemd/Manifest
+++ b/sys-libs/libmodulemd/Manifest
@@ -1,5 +1,4 @@
-AUX libmodulemd-2.14.0-meson-version.patch 2515 BLAKE2B 962d041738a7b34e2ca5427f9205374f3b674f1c077fe46e28ac563da372deafd2b964502c3f4df447d48cc3b9da3514a3054d1a9389cb2fbab2421db77398c6 SHA512 69ac775c19c1506863e4dbd53e2a816ada5e8f3d497843f067ab7e1cf186a994d98741d378be3380cbf5ff7c0756e067472c8c22da7496b93ab8b81bd51224af
-DIST libmodulemd-2.14.0.tar.gz 531166 BLAKE2B 18c3693ef9f74c57c71c7bd80b16d60d0fc2c8732994acae9b8461af5776bfcf8b856eef65222470d070fd256c6ee1468f961ba20b4425502f946d3368e5708c SHA512 dee8e08ada4e246179f88342cd3d3d6736f430b362e36ab1a3605971033ad306a5bf415141a09180a7ea6e70d1532d63d815ca07f208222447b455b9ff0e6f75
-EBUILD libmodulemd-2.14.0.ebuild 1503 BLAKE2B cfd2d21b4e466ff28be8ee1c2f29467d31a7ea75ddecf4a1db2c5f66f7aec302d82e056911a556e9de4ec5bc6f680baff6497caf67298496892dd5f52a17cffb SHA512 1d61f0ff88315d5545524c29223eaf937ca0f399127dbf896b0cc7b763452b166dbb1d2045f53f17ba24b2b15b3a937c19e4f15a284fcff706b188d76e8731f6
+DIST libmodulemd-2.15.0.tar.gz 572396 BLAKE2B 39e9240deb4e1a3278bf323e111b137b980ac5a3069598b7306390d27623730ac1bc826c91ed049257c0d5de8c6a05c3bbc22ac8e9435b5c38c147f0f077ec41 SHA512 6e890952bf6b6fe3ee5790ff71866938627134eaa2d6c6e3bf1940dcf21203dc0101f487801d62f3698e5a50402eb089665c99723aeffd831e5f0b341a63aace
+EBUILD libmodulemd-2.15.0.ebuild 1451 BLAKE2B 7ad6f0b1b5a83d84ba5be83a6cb5fe56c7b508201abf501a67043799de4e48cf0c04da1bbd0ddbbadfc1af50550aaa783f5141329398cf0c6c6a963449335af4 SHA512 d3f08ec3f2f681b45d1363a5713079fbd82cdbb132a01d7e6b0bc798638272bcf1d4bd8f2b85f9857d87db471b3ec52befea15904f62eaddd07dfdc1574b9143
EBUILD libmodulemd-9999.ebuild 1446 BLAKE2B a87a066975aa2c64c7ecf99c713602d56d25d80e55bd4f34002311ec0369e2d58000b408237ff138fff20855dd4280ebd87f6e1fea74780fd266912c663999ce SHA512 1427785e18b464b02ee8f636701e08f40fe8a85630ff1d0d2d5bb412e5956ae5365e3c31c50d55ccffbee1920b213e06cfe4511569d514f82fa8040c90023137
MISC metadata.xml 497 BLAKE2B 177b48e70f6f07c00184dad0d1571f72f35e37cc76253d0d86d0a85688705d5f108b14f3a8cd356614c0bbf7fad34af89c560c1e0801cf495802a2a72334d558 SHA512 4660fcb35515d0df20e19da1f2d69d966f36f0ddad1b6008507289ce6741d5a83a519c933991d4bb65cc29a15eaa34106a93cd6cdb7362f3ac287e3184eda37e
diff --git a/sys-libs/libmodulemd/files/libmodulemd-2.14.0-meson-version.patch b/sys-libs/libmodulemd/files/libmodulemd-2.14.0-meson-version.patch
deleted file mode 100644
index bd006f66310c..000000000000
--- a/sys-libs/libmodulemd/files/libmodulemd-2.14.0-meson-version.patch
+++ /dev/null
@@ -1,61 +0,0 @@
-https://github.com/fedora-modularity/libmodulemd/pull/604
-From: Matt Jolly <Matt.Jolly@footclan.ninja>
-Date: Fri, 27 Jan 2023 16:03:09 +1100
-Subject: [PATCH] Meson build tidyup
-
-- Set meson_version to actual required version
-- Update deprecated functions to supported equivalents
---- a/meson.build
-+++ b/meson.build
-@@ -15,7 +15,7 @@ project(
- version : '2.14.1',
- default_options : ['buildtype=debugoptimized', 'c_std=c11', 'warning_level=1', 'b_asneeded=true'],
- license : 'MIT',
--meson_version : '>=0.47.0'
-+meson_version : '>=0.58.0'
- )
-
- libmodulemd_version = meson.project_version()
-@@ -58,7 +58,7 @@ rpm = dependency('rpm', required : with_rpmio)
- magic = cc.find_library('magic', required : with_libmagic)
-
- glib = dependency('glib-2.0')
--glib_prefix = glib.get_pkgconfig_variable('prefix')
-+glib_prefix = glib.get_variable(pkgconfig: 'prefix')
-
- bash = find_program('bash')
- sed = find_program('sed')
---- a/modulemd/meson.build
-+++ b/modulemd/meson.build
-@@ -286,9 +286,9 @@ endif
- # Test env with release values
- test_release_env = environment()
- test_release_env.set('LC_ALL', 'C')
--test_release_env.set ('MESON_SOURCE_ROOT', meson.source_root())
--test_release_env.set ('MESON_BUILD_ROOT', meson.build_root())
--test_release_env.set ('TEST_DATA_PATH', meson.source_root() + '/modulemd/tests/test_data')
-+test_release_env.set ('MESON_SOURCE_ROOT', meson.project_source_root())
-+test_release_env.set ('MESON_BUILD_ROOT', meson.project_build_root())
-+test_release_env.set ('TEST_DATA_PATH', meson.project_source_root() + '/modulemd/tests/test_data')
-
- # Test env with fatal warnings and criticals
- test_env = test_release_env
-@@ -304,9 +304,9 @@ py_test_env = test_env
- if not test_installed_lib
- # If we're testing an installed version, we want to use the default
- # locations for these paths.
-- py_test_env.set ('GI_TYPELIB_PATH', meson.build_root() + '/modulemd')
-- py_test_env.set ('LD_LIBRARY_PATH', meson.build_root() + '/modulemd')
-- py_test_env.set ('PYTHONPATH', meson.source_root())
-+ py_test_env.set ('GI_TYPELIB_PATH', meson.project_build_root() + '/modulemd')
-+ py_test_env.set ('LD_LIBRARY_PATH', meson.project_build_root() + '/modulemd')
-+ py_test_env.set ('PYTHONPATH', meson.project_source_root())
-
- # This test is just to catch whether we are accidentally not testing
- # the built version.
-@@ -558,5 +558,3 @@ test('test_import_headers', import_header_script,
- args : modulemd_hdrs,
- timeout : 300,
- suite : ['smoketest', 'ci'])
--
--
diff --git a/sys-libs/libmodulemd/libmodulemd-2.14.0.ebuild b/sys-libs/libmodulemd/libmodulemd-2.15.0.ebuild
index 73c64f917ae4..72b02229c8f2 100644
--- a/sys-libs/libmodulemd/libmodulemd-2.14.0.ebuild
+++ b/sys-libs/libmodulemd/libmodulemd-2.15.0.ebuild
@@ -48,8 +48,6 @@ BDEPEND="
)
"
-PATCHES=( "${FILESDIR}"/${P}-meson-version.patch )
-
src_configure() {
local emesonargs=(
$(meson_use gtk-doc with_docs)